Understanding THC Marijuana in Italy
In Italy, THC (Tetrahydrocannabinol) is the psychoactive compound found in cannabis․ The sale and possession of THC marijuana are regulated by law․ While medical marijuana is legal with a prescription, recreational use is subject to certain restrictions․
Legal Status of THC Marijuana in Milan
As of the latest updates, Milan follows Italian national law regarding cannabis․ The sale of THC marijuana is not legalized for recreational purposes, but there are exceptions for medical and research purposes with proper authorization․
Where to Buy THC Marijuana in Milan
For those looking to purchase THC marijuana in Milan, there are a few avenues to explore:
- Authorized Cannabis Clinics: For medical purposes, patients can obtain THC marijuana from authorized clinics with a doctor’s prescription․
- Illegal Market: Some individuals may attempt to sell THC marijuana on the black market․ However, this is against the law and can pose significant risks․
- Cannabis Light Shops: While not selling THC marijuana, some shops sell cannabis light products that contain very low THC levels․ These are legal and can be found in Milan․
